Finnish game developer Supercell has made a surprising announcement: after canceling their RPG, Clash Heroes, they're reviving the concept as Project R.I.S.E. This isn't a simple relaunch, however.

The Full Story:

Clash Heroes is officially defunct. Following in the footsteps of Clash Mini, it's been shelved. However, Supercell is giving the game a new life with Project R.I.S.E., a social action RPG roguelite within the Clash universe.

Supercell's announcement video, featuring game lead Julien Le Cadre, directly addressed the cancellation of Clash Heroes, but emphasized the positive: Project R.I.S.E. maintains the Clash theme while shifting focus to a multiplayer action RPG experience.

Project R.I.S.E. shares DNA with Clash Heroes but is a completely rebuilt game. Players will team up in three-person squads to explore The Tower, a procedurally generated structure with unique challenges on each floor. Unlike the solo PvE focus of its predecessor, Project R.I.S.E. prioritizes cooperative gameplay and diverse character interactions.

Currently in pre-alpha, Project R.I.S.E. is slated for its first playtest in early July 2024. Interested players can register on the official website for a chance to participate.
